    _ It would seem that could be a good move for his development considering that the Canadian league is more pass oriented with only three downs to get a first. _
    I sort of like CFL football. They have some quirky rules, like the three downs you mentioned. They have others like, if I am correct, having to field a punt, and the backfield can be in motion prior to the snap. Also, the size of the field is different, they award rouge point, etc.

    Takes a little getting accustomed to, which I did when stationed in N Dak, and had opportunities to view Winnipeg games in person.
